General Description
The MAX887 high-efficiency, step-down DC-DC converter provides an adjustable output from 1.25V to 10.5V. It accepts inputs from 3.5V to 11V and delivers 600mA. Operation to 100% duty cycle minimizes dropout voltage (300mV typ at 500mA). Synchronous rectification reduces output rectifier losses, resulting in efficiency as high as 95%.
Fixed-frequency pulse-width modulation (PWM) reduces noise in sensitive communications applications. Using a high-frequency internal oscillator allows tiny surface-mount components to reduce PC board area, and eliminates audio-frequency interference. A SYNC input allows synchronization to an external clock to avoid interference with sensitive RF and data acquisition circuits.
FEATUREs
♦ 95% Efficiency
♦ 600mA Output Current
♦ Cycle-by-Cycle Current Limiting
♦ Low-Dropout, 100% Duty-Cycle Operation, 300mV at 500mA
♦ Internal 0.6Ω (typ) MOSFET
♦ Internal Synchronous Rectifier
♦ High-Frequency Current-Mode PWM
♦ External SYNC or Internal 300kHz Oscillator
♦ Guaranteed 260kHz to 340kHz Internal Oscillator Frequency Limits
♦ 2.5µA Shutdown Mode
